Build me a polished little project called UI Skills for design engineers. I want it to work as both a simple website and a command line tool. The main idea is that people can discover practical UI skills, browse them by category, and open a specific skill to read it, while the CLI can start by routing an agent toward the right UI skill set for a task, show categories, list skills in a category, and fetch a skill by name.
Please make it feel clean, modern, and easy to use, with the skills content acting like the single source of truth for both the site and the CLI. The website should feel like a real public resource, not just a dev demo, with a nice landing page and clear skill pages. The CLI should be straightforward and friendly.
Also add enough setup and usage docs so someone can run it locally and understand the main commands quickly. If you need details, look up current docs online and make sensible choices.
